Here’s what’s really happening inside your body:
When you eat carbohydrates, your digestive system breaks them down into sugar molecules , which then enter your bloodstream. Your blood sugar rises, and your body releases insulin to move that sugar into your cells for energy.

But here’s the twist:
If that sugar isn’t used right away, your body stores it as fat . Highly refined carbs—like white bread, pastries, or foods with high fructose corn syrup—are digested almost instantly, causing a rapid spike in blood sugar followed by a crash.

This “sugar rush” leaves you tired, hungry again, and sometimes even cranky.

Protein.

It’s not just for muscle—it’s a secret weapon against sugar crashes. By slowing the absorption of sugar into your bloodstream, protein helps:

  • Keep your energy steady throughout the day
  • Reduce cravings for sugary snacks
  • Keep you feeling fuller, longer

Combine protein with low-GI carbs like berries, apples, lentils, and whole grains, and you’ve got a simple, powerful strategy to stop the energy rollercoaster. Imagine powering through your afternoons—focused, energized, and craving-free.
